I need suggestions on how to tame my six (unclipped) peachfaced lovebirds! I just want them tame enough to step up on command and let me stroke them. I've tried everything I could think of, but they'll only come to me for millet spray,but we run out of that really quickly, and they aren't supposed to have that much. Any suggestions?

The thing that you want from your bird is TRUST. Cool

This is something that will take time and effort from you.

Somethings that you can do:
- be around you bird as much as you can and they will get used to you (you can make your homework)
- you can try to get your bird to feed from you hand (start with millet, that is long so you can hold it and at the same time there is distance between your hand and your bird)
